Rubber Roofing – The ideal Choice
Excessively numerous FMs depend on a "settle things when they break" mindset, which isn't a support program by any means. Preventive...

Rubber Roofing in Oklahoma City
In the event that you as of now have a current rooftop with no real issues, you may in any case need to secure against ice dams. You...